Will Republicans Swallow the Poizner Pill?

It has been noted that in this last election cycle, not one seat in the Legislature changed partisan hands. One seat that came close, though, was the 21st Assembly District on the San Francisco peninsula. In a “safe” Democrat seat, Ira Ruskin, the Democrat, eked out a 52-48 percent win over his Republican opponent, businessman Steve Poizner, who made a big splash by spending millions of his personal wealth on the race.

Now Poizner has set his sights on the race for state Insurance Commissioner, meriting a closer look at this enigmatic, ersatz politician.
